Tested & Approved

  • The Walker is tested and fully approved according to ISO 11199-2:2005, the relevant standard for rollators.
  • The Walker is registered as a “Class 1 Medical Device”, and it bears a CE-mark.
  • The Walker includes a 10-year guarantee*, parts subject to wear excluded.
